On the Waterfront (USA, 1954) [PG]
A former prize fighter turned dock worker witnesses a murder committed on the orders of his union bosses, a crime which he unknowingly aided, and must decide whether to continue to keep his head down or stand up against those responsible, including his own brother.
In the 27th Academy Awards, On the Waterfront won Best Picture, Best Director [Elia Kazan], Best Actor [Marlon Brando], Best Supporting Actress [Eva Marie Saint], Best Story and Screenplay [Budd Schulberg], as well as Best Art Direction, Best Cinematography, and Best Editing. Leonard Bernstein’s music, his only purely instrumental film score, was nominated but did not win.
